Foreign Secretary gives condolences for French train accident

The Foreign Secretary has expressed condolences for the loss of life and injuries caused by the train accident at Bretigny-sur-Orge near Paris.

This was published under the 2010 to 2015 Conservative and Liberal Democrat coalition government

Speaking about the train accident south of Paris today where seven people have been confirmed dead, the Foreign Secretary said:

I was shocked to hear about the serious train crash outside Paris. My thoughts are with the victims and their families. The British Embassy in Paris is in close touch with the French authorities and stands by to provide any assistance required.

The Foreign Office currently has no information at this stage that British nationals are amongst the casualties but we stand ready to provide any assistance that may be needed.
